#143ca0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#143ca0 is composed of 7.8% red, 23.5%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.5%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 35.3%. #143ca0 color hex could be obtained by blending #2878ff with #000041.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#143ca0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f1f4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#143ca0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595a5b is the less saturated color, while #0636ae is the most saturated one.
